什么是虚拟机?
💡
原文英文,约700词,阅读约需3分钟。
📝
内容提要
虚拟机是物理计算机的软件模拟,允许多个操作系统在一台主机上运行,使用虚拟机监控器技术。容器是轻量级的软件包,包含运行所需的所有元素,与虚拟机相比更轻便、启动快、易移植且成本低。虚拟机需要完整操作系统,而容器共享主机操作系统,适合快速部署和大规模应用。
🎯
关键要点
- 虚拟机是物理计算机的软件模拟,允许多个操作系统在一台主机上运行。
- 虚拟机使用虚拟机监控器技术,每个虚拟机都有完整的操作系统和虚拟硬件组件。
- 虚拟机监控器分为两种类型:类型1(裸金属虚拟机监控器)和类型2(托管虚拟机监控器)。
- 容器是轻量级的软件包,包含运行所需的所有元素,能够在任何环境中运行。
- 容器虚拟化操作系统,适合快速部署和大规模应用,具有轻便、可移植和自包含的特点。
- 虚拟机和容器的主要区别包括操作系统架构、可移植性、性能、虚拟化方式、成本和使用便利性。
- 容器比虚拟机更便宜,使用更少的CPU和内存,且体积更小,易于使用。
❓
延伸问答
虚拟机的定义是什么?
虚拟机是物理计算机的软件模拟,允许多个操作系统在一台主机上运行。
虚拟机和容器有什么主要区别?
虚拟机需要完整的操作系统,而容器共享主机操作系统,容器更轻便、启动快、易移植且成本低。
虚拟机监控器的类型有哪些?
虚拟机监控器分为类型1(裸金属虚拟机监控器)和类型2(托管虚拟机监控器)。
容器的特点是什么?
容器是轻量级的软件包,包含运行所需的所有元素,能够在任何环境中运行,具有可移植和自包含的特点。
使用虚拟机的主要优势是什么?
虚拟机允许在一台物理主机上运行多个操作系统,提供了良好的隔离性和资源管理。
为什么容器比虚拟机更便宜?
容器使用更少的CPU和内存,且体积更小,因此在资源有限的情况下更具成本效益。
➡️